Except... that even given efficient use, a book is printed once, holds exactly one book, and will not hold more... no one erases a book and prints a new one on it... while a PDA can hold hundreds, even thousands of books.
That's hundreds to thousands of books versus one PDA. And when a PDA discards a book, it is not landfilled. So the environmental footprint of a single device does in fact trump the much larger footprint of hundreds to thousands of books.
